I’ve been trying to come up with alternative gift ideas for the holidays. Today I discovered the Massachusetts Audubon Society, which is primarily located 30 minutes from my house.

So here’s an idea: give a membership to the Massachusetts Audubon Society as a gift! The above image depicts all of the wildlife sanctuaries that members can visit.

Don’t live in Massachusetts? Look up your local Audubon Society.
